Discovery Sport Forum banner

Discussions Showcase Albums Media Media Comments Tags Marketplace

1-1 of 1 Results
  1. Appearance & Body
    I plan to purchase these Defender replacement doors I found online, but I cannot attach them to my vehicle by myself. I need the help of a professional. Can someone please recommend any local auto shops here in the UK? Preferably those with licensed technicians. Thanks in advance!
1-1 of 1 Results